If your outlet is not working because of a tripped breaker, you’ll see the breaker lever in the middle position (between ON and OFF), and perhaps also an orange indicator on …How to check your outlets. The best way to check an outlet if you suspect it’s not working correctly is to use a multi-meter. To do this, you set the multi-meter to the setting that has a single “V” because this is the setting used for checking a 110/120-volt power load. Once your multi-meter is turned on to this …

CARS.COM — If you have a 12-volt power outlet that suddenly decided it didn’t want to work, the first thing to check is whether the phone charger or whatever 12-volt accessory you’re ...The power accessory relay controls all the accessory power inside your Venza. The relay typically is off when the key is off, but when we turn the key to “Acc” position, it turns on and provides power to accessory outlets inside our Venza. However, if this relay gets damaged due to a surge current or aging, the 12V power outlet will …Another possible issue is your inverter.
